🙂Monthly costs for one person with rent: $825 in Cuiaba versus $1,003 in Medellin.
🙂Estimated couple costs with rent: $1,246 in Cuiaba versus $1,573 in Medellin.
🙂Monthly costs for a family of three with rent: $1,668 in Cuiaba versus $2,143 in Medellin.
🌍Living in Cuiaba costs roughly 18% less than in Medellin, driven mainly by Groceries & Markets.
📊Both cities sit below the global median: Cuiaba38% lower, Medellin25% lower.

Cuiaba vs Medellin: Cost of Living - Frequently Asked Questions
Which city is more expensive, Cuiaba or Medellin?
Cuiaba wins on cost – living expenses run 22% lower than in Medellin. Housing and daily spending are where you'll feel the difference most, making Cuiaba the obvious pick if budget is a priority.
Are salaries higher in Cuiaba or in Medellin?
On paper, salaries run 49% lower in Medellin. That's worth factoring in alongside costs, though remote workers earning in a stronger currency may not notice the difference at all.
How much does a 1-bedroom apartment cost in Cuiaba compared to Medellin?
Rent for a central apartment: $281 in Cuiaba versus $475 in Medellin. Housing is usually the single largest factor when comparing overall living costs between the two.
How do dining costs compare in Cuiaba and in Medellin?
Dining out is cheaper in Cuiaba – a meal for two runs $18.00 versus $33.00 in Medellin. If you eat out regularly, this makes a real dent in your monthly spending.
How much does it cost to live in Cuiaba compared to Medellin?
All in, you'll spend $825 per month in Cuiaba versus $1,003 in Medellin – a 22% gap that adds up to real savings over time for anyone picking the cheaper option.
Can you live on $1,000/month in Cuiaba or in Medellin?
At $825 in Cuiaba versus $1,003 in Medellin, a $1,000 budget is realistic in Cuiaba but tight or insufficient in Medellin. The gap between the two cities makes Cuiaba the clear choice for anyone on this budget.
Which city is better for digital nomads, Cuiaba or Medellin?
Both work as nomad bases, but Cuiaba delivers better value – similar infrastructure at $825 monthly. If stretching your runway or maximizing savings is the goal, the price difference makes Cuiaba hard to pass up.
Which city is more affordable for expats?
Expats usually find Cuiaba gentler on the wallet – expenses run 22% less than in Medellin. Beyond cost, consider language, visa policies, and how big the international community is in each city.
